From 69bfe12a7a5e3cecf15c1cd632f4434aa0fbe8eb Mon Sep 17 00:00:00 2001 From: Tiger Date: Fri, 23 Aug 2019 16:05:55 +1000 Subject: Default clusters namespace_per_environment to true --- ...ult-clusters-namespace_per_environment-column-to-true.yml | 5 +++++ ...5948_change_clusters_namespace_per_environment_default.rb | 12 ++++++++++++ db/schema.rb | 2 +- 3 files changed, 18 insertions(+), 1 deletion(-) create mode 100644 changelogs/unreleased/65251-default-clusters-namespace_per_environment-column-to-true.yml create mode 100644 db/migrate/20190823055948_change_clusters_namespace_per_environment_default.rb diff --git a/changelogs/unreleased/65251-default-clusters-namespace_per_environment-column-to-true.yml b/changelogs/unreleased/65251-default-clusters-namespace_per_environment-column-to-true.yml new file mode 100644 index 00000000000..c0bc20b2485 --- /dev/null +++ b/changelogs/unreleased/65251-default-clusters-namespace_per_environment-column-to-true.yml @@ -0,0 +1,5 @@ +--- +title: Default clusters namespace_per_environment column to true +merge_request: 32139 +author: +type: other diff --git a/db/migrate/20190823055948_change_clusters_namespace_per_environment_default.rb b/db/migrate/20190823055948_change_clusters_namespace_per_environment_default.rb new file mode 100644 index 00000000000..919ce807869 --- /dev/null +++ b/db/migrate/20190823055948_change_clusters_namespace_per_environment_default.rb @@ -0,0 +1,12 @@ +# frozen_string_literal: true + +# See http://doc.gitlab.com/ce/development/migration_style_guide.html +# for more information on how to write migrations for GitLab. + +class ChangeClustersNamespacePerEnvironmentDefault < ActiveRecord::Migration[5.2] + DOWNTIME = false + + def change + change_column_default :clusters, :namespace_per_environment, from: false, to: true + end +end diff --git a/db/schema.rb b/db/schema.rb index 13572022235..f1dbe5c322c 100644 --- a/db/schema.rb +++ b/db/schema.rb @@ -935,7 +935,7 @@ ActiveRecord::Schema.define(version: 2019_08_28_083843) do t.integer "cluster_type", limit: 2, default: 3, null: false t.string "domain" t.boolean "managed", default: true, null: false - t.boolean "namespace_per_environment", default: false, null: false + t.boolean "namespace_per_environment", default: true, null: false t.index ["enabled"], name: "index_clusters_on_enabled" t.index ["user_id"], name: "index_clusters_on_user_id" end -- cgit v1.2.1